Educational requirements: BSc degree or equivalent qualification in a relevant subject from a recognised university.

Professional experience required: Preferably 3 years of practical or research work experience.

Language requirements: TOEFL (minimum score: 550 + TWE 4.5 paper, 213 computer, 83 internet.); IELTS (minimum score: 6.0.)

Objectives: To train engineers and hydro-scientists to the use and development of modelling and communication technology tools for solving water engineering/management problems in urban and environmental contexts.

Subjects: Fluid dynamics; hydraulics and hydrological modelling; urban and environmental processes; data-driven modelling; systems/project management; systems engineering and design; artificial intelligence.

Modes of instruction: Lectures, exercises, computer-based tutorials and workshops. Hands-on training to modelling packages. Laboratory sessions, fieldwork and fieldtrips. Group work with students from other institutes.
